什么是小型计算机系统接口?

小型计算机系统接口是连接外设和计算机的高速标准。它也被缩写为SCSI,它定义了硬件连接和数据交换方法。对于每种受支持的外设类型,SCSI定义了特定于设备的命令和协议。SCSI通常用于高性能计算机和服务器,例如用于视频和音频生产的计算机和服务器。它通常与独立磁盘冗余阵列(RAID)和网络存储技术一起使用。

圆珠笔、模糊、特写、电脑、景深、书桌、电子设备、焦点、前台、女孩、手、室内、工作、键盘、笔记本、笔记、笔、远程工作、屏幕、桌子、技术、触摸板、网络研讨会、女人、工作、工作空间、工作场所、免费股票照片

SCSI是在1970年代后期创建的,最初被命名为Shugart Associates系统接口以纪念它的企业发明者。与竞争技术相比,小型计算机系统接口有几个优势。它的数据线很长,可以很容易地将许多外部设备连接到计算机上。电缆上的多个高性能设备可以同时处于活动状态,加快存储密集型应用程序的速度。例如,编辑软件可以同时从两个硬盘读取数据和刻录一个数字视频光盘(DVD)。

从20世纪80年代到21世纪初,小型计算机系统接口的规格有了相当大的发展。并行SCSI总线从8位增加到16位,并且设备带宽经常从一个版本增加到下一个版本。许多主板包括兼容的SCSI控制器或SCSI主机总线适配器(HBA)卡。磁盘制造商通常在其他技术之前引入具有SCSI支持的高性能驱动器。然而,低成本的集成驱动电子(IDE)磁盘仍然是个人电脑的普遍选择。

小型计算机系统接口将连接的设备组织成逻辑驱动器、目标和启动器。如果一个设备能够初始化SCSI命令,比如SCSI控制器,那么它就是一个启动器。磁盘驱动器、DVD驱动器和类似设备等目标设备响应发起者的请求。每个目标设备可以有多个逻辑驱动器和多个逻辑数据块。特别是,高容量存储设备通常作为多个虚拟驱动器访问。

小型计算机系统接口命令协议定义了几十种操作。包括用于管理设备、收集状态和传输数据的命令。除了四个不同的写命令外,还有四种不同的从设备读取数据的方法。32位循环冗余检查(CRC32)方法自从1996年SCSI-3规范发布以来就被用于数据传输。

在本世纪初,SCSI总线时钟频率已经增加到160兆赫(MHz)与超640规范。SCSI的并行性质开始导致终止和布线问题在非常高的速度。这些问题通过重新设计SCSI以串行而不是并行地传输数据来解决。这些变化是在2000年后期作为串行附加SCSI (SAS)实施的。一个重要的变化,光纤通道仲裁环(FC-AL)使用一个非常快的时钟,4千兆赫(GHz),与光纤电缆。

与并行SCSI相比,SAS除了提供更高的设备性能之外,还有几个优点。设备连接是热插拔的,这意味着它们可以根据需要被拔掉或插入,而不需要关闭服务器。SAS兼容串行先进技术附件(SATA)存储设备。这允许最流行、价格最低的SATA驱动器(IDE的继承者)与基于scsi的先进技术一起使用。SAS还在原来的小型计算机系统接口上改进了故障隔离。

发表评论

电子邮件地址不会被公开。 必填项已用*标注